Jalapeno Popper Chili Recipe

This hearty Jalapeno Popper Chili recipe takes roughly 30 minutes to make. Combining chili beans, ground beef, and jalapenos along with a few other tasty ingredients, this recipe is sure to warm you up!

Ingredients

• 2 pounds ground beef• 1/2 sweet yellow onion diced• 1 green bell pepper diced• 1/2 tsp kosher salt• 1/2 tsp black pepper• 2 (10 oz) containers mild pico de gallo• 1 jalapeño, finely diced (seeds and ribs removed for milder chili)• 3 cans pinto chili beans (with chili pepper, onion & garlic in a tomato sauce) do not drain juice• 2 Tbsp cumin• 8 oz cream cheese

Instructions

1. In a large pot, heat on medium, add ground beef, and cook halfway, then add diced onions and bell pepper to the beef. Cook until beef is brown and veggies are softened. Seasoning with salt and pepper. 2. Add pico de gallo, jalapeño, chili beans, and cumin, stir, cover the pan and bring to a simmer. Simmer for about 15 minutes. 3. Add the cream cheese, cover, and simmer again for 15 minutes. Once cream cheese is soft remove lid, and stir in cream cheese until fully mixed. Keep at a low temperature until you are ready to serve.

Recipe Notes

Freeze remaining for another night. Tastes great with warm cornbread.
